What troubles do these principals and classmates have? In the past few years, primary and secondary schools had balanced acceptance inspections. In order to pass the inspections, schools had to invest a lot of money in debt. In recent years, schools have been operating with debt. However, in recent years, the situation has become more serious. There are financial difficulties in various places, and school funds are not allocated on time. In order to continue normal operations, schools owe more and more debts. Every Spring Festival, there are no calls for debts. Now some merchants have heard that when schools want to purchase items, the first condition is that they cannot use credit (because there are too many debts). If the school wants to operate normally, the money must be spent. As the person in charge of the school, the principal can only use his own money first. The salary has been advanced, but the funds have been unable to come down. It is not enough to continue to advance it! This is the reason why several normal school students are unwilling to serve as principals of primary and secondary schools. It is difficult to be a leader! Since being a principal is difficult, why not just resign? Why be so pretentious? Who knows they also have difficulties. They said that if they were still in the position of principal, if one day the funds came out, they would be able to get the money they advanced quickly. However, if they resigned from the position of principal, they would no longer be the principal and would wait for someone else to become the principal. , whether the money advanced by oneself can be paid out smoothly is a question. If I continue to be the principal, the school must continue to operate and be paid with my own salary. When will this end? If I quit my job, can I successfully get out the money I have advanced? \”To be a principal or not to be a principal\” is indeed a difficult problem for them. A screenshot of a WeChat group chat in a class of the 13th primary school in a county in a central province shows that the teacher issued a notice saying, “Dear parents: Due to the county financialWe have been in arrears with our school\’s office funds. This morning, the Electric Power Bureau began to stop the power supply to our school. \”The notice also stated that because the classroom light was too dark, the school suspended evening extended services from that day, and the school dismissal time was also adjusted. And due to the power outage, the school\’s electric gate cannot be used, and students must enter from the side door. \”In addition, because the school cannot Boiling water is provided, please bring your own. \”The above news is absolutely true and did happen. Do you think school teachers would lie? If the teachers did not lie, where did the funds that should be allocated go? Just in the first half of the year, parents of students from a public school in Shaanxi Province released news through the Internet It was said that on Friday morning, which was a normal school day, the school received a notice to take the children home because the school was in arrears and had a power outage. The parents of the students also attached a screenshot of the school’s emergency notice, which showed that the notice was issued by the student. The work center issued a notice saying that due to the school being in arrears, the power was cut off and normal teaching could not be carried out. Parents were asked to come to the school to pick up their children at 10:30 noon and wait for the notice. After the incident was exposed, some media interviewed the education department. However, the staff of the district education bureau said that they would not accept interviews. The above two news can be found on the Internet. They are absolutely true!
